Maintenance Assitant

Complete Care - Wisconsin · Pleasant Prairie, WI · 1 wk ago
HealthcareFull-time

About the role

Position: Full-Time Maintenance Assistant. Full Time, Day Shift.

Responsibilities

  • Troubleshoot building mechanical problems effectively.
  • Perform repairs and conduct scheduled preventative maintenance on equipment to ensure satisfactory operations.
  • Apply technical knowledge of electrical systems, as well as heating, ventilating,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ems.
  • Maintain Safety: Follow all established safety rules, policies, and procedures of the maintenance department.
  • Collaborate: Complete other duties as assigned by the Maintenance Director and Administrator.

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or equivalent required.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a collaborative team.
  • Basic computer skills.
  • Previous experience in a long-term care (LTC) setting is preferred but not required.
  • Experience performing basic building repairs and maintenance, including plumbing, carpentry, and painting.
  • Completion of a maintenance apprenticeship is preferred.
  • Strong troubleshooting, organizational, and time management skills.
  • Ability to prioritize tasks and respond to maintenance needs in a timely manner.
